Description

R-(+)-Norketamine is a key chiral intermediate and metabolite of the anesthetic ketamine, distinguished by its specific (R)-(+) enantiomeric form. This high-purity compound is essential for advanced pharmaceutical research and development, particularly in the study of neuropharmacology and the synthesis of novel therapeutic agents. It is primarily utilized by research institutions, pharmaceutical developers, and analytical laboratories focused on central nervous system (CNS) drug discovery and metabolite reference standards.

Application

  • Pharmaceutical Reference Standard: Serves as a certified metabolite standard for pharmacokinetic and bioanalytical studies of ketamine.
  • Neuropharmacology Research: Used in preclinical research to investigate the mechanisms of action, metabolism, and neurobiological effects of ketamine and its analogs.
  • Active Pharmaceutical Ingredient (API) Intermediate: A critical chiral building block in the synthetic pathway for developing new CNS-targeting pharmaceuticals.
  • Metabolite Identification & Profiling: Essential for drug metabolism and disposition (DMPK) studies to identify and quantify metabolic pathways.
  • Analytical Chemistry: Employed as a high-purity calibrant in methods development for techniques like HPLC, LC-MS, and GC-MS.
  • Forensic & Clinical Toxicology: Used as a reference material for the accurate detection and quantification of ketamine metabolites in forensic and clinical samples.

Basic Information

Product Name R-(+)-Norketamine
CAS No. 83777-64-4
Molecular Formula C12H14ClNO
Molecular Weight 223.70 g/mol
Synonyms (R)-2-(2-Chlorophenyl)-2-(methylamino)cyclohexanone; (R)-Norketamine; (+)-Norketamine; (R)-(+)-2-Amino-2-(2-chlorophenyl)cyclohexanone; Desmethylketamine (R-enantiomer); Nor-Ketamine (R-form); CL-88 Metabolite (R+)
